Understanding Your Landscape Maintenance Needs

Before you even begin researching landscape maintenance companies, it’s essential to define your specific needs. Consider the following:

  • Lawn Care: Do you need regular mowing, fertilization, weed control, aeration, and overseeding?
  • Garden Maintenance: Are there flower beds, shrubs, or trees that require pruning, planting, mulching, and pest control?
  • Irrigation: Do you have an irrigation system that needs maintenance, repairs, or adjustments?
  • Seasonal Services: Do you need leaf removal in the fall or snow removal in the winter?
  • Specialty Services: Do you require services like hardscape maintenance, water feature cleaning, or landscape design?

Once you have a clear understanding of your needs, you can narrow down your search to landscape maintenance companies that offer the specific services you require. This will save you time and effort in the long run.

Evaluating Landscape Maintenance Companies: Key Factors to Consider

Once you have your shortlist, it’s time to evaluate each landscape maintenance company based on several key factors:

Licensing and Insurance

Ensure that the landscape maintenance company is properly licensed and insured. Licensing requirements vary by state and locality, but typically involve demonstrating competence and adhering to certain standards. Insurance, including general liability and workers’ compensation, protects you from liability in case of accidents or damages on your property. Ask for proof of both licensing and insurance before hiring a company.

Experience and Expertise

Consider the company’s experience in the industry. How long have they been in business? Do they have experience with landscapes similar to yours? A company with a proven track record is more likely to provide reliable and high-quality service. Also, inquire about the qualifications and training of their employees. Do they have certified arborists, horticulturists, or other specialists on staff?

Services Offered

Make sure the landscape maintenance company offers all the services you need. Some companies specialize in certain areas, such as lawn care or tree care, while others offer a comprehensive range of services. Choose a company that can meet all your needs, both now and in the future. Equipment and Technology

A reputable landscape maintenance company should have well-maintained equipment and utilize modern technology. This ensures efficiency, precision, and environmentally responsible practices. Inquire about the types of equipment they use and their commitment to sustainable practices.

Customer Service and Communication

Pay attention to the company’s customer service and communication skills. Are they responsive to your inquiries? Do they communicate clearly and professionally? A company that values customer service is more likely to be responsive to your needs and address any concerns promptly. Good communication is essential for a successful long-term relationship.

Pricing and Contracts

Obtain detailed quotes from each landscape maintenance company on your shortlist. Make sure the quotes clearly outline the services included, the frequency of visits, and the payment terms. Compare the quotes carefully, but don’t base your decision solely on price. Consider the value you’re receiving for the price. Also, review the contract carefully before signing. Make sure you understand the terms and conditions, including cancellation policies and dispute resolution procedures.

Questions to Ask Landscape Maintenance Companies

When interviewing potential landscape maintenance companies, be sure to ask the following questions:

  • Are you licensed and insured?
  • How long have you been in business?
  • What services do you offer?
  • Do you have experience with landscapes similar to mine?
  • What types of equipment do you use?
  • What is your approach to sustainable landscaping?
  • Can you provide references from satisfied customers?
  • What is your pricing structure?
  • What are your payment terms?
  • What is your cancellation policy?
  • How do you handle complaints or disputes?
